Acqui Terme railway station
Acqui Terme railway station (Italian: Stazione di Acqui Terme) serves the town and comune of Acqui Terme, in the Piedmont region of northwestern Italy.

The Acqui Terme station is the railway station of the Acqui Terme. At this stop, the Asti-Genoa railway crosses with the Alessandria-San Giuseppe di Cairo.
It is located in Piazza Vittorio Veneto near the historic center of the town.
